Overview
The monitor-vite-admin project is an innovative web monitoring framework utilizing a unified frontend scaffolding. Designed primarily on Vite’s lightweight framework, this admin dashboard offers essential functionalities such as layout management, basic routing, and an efficient coding architecture. Although there might be temporary downtime due to resource issues, the tiny version allows for easy setup and quick demonstrations through mock modes.
This project is built with the latest dependencies and upgrades in mind, including the modernized Vite 7.x, along with robust tools like React, MobX, and Ant Design. The extensive features cater to seamless development experiences, making it an attractive option for both personal and professional projects.
Features
- Lightweight Framework: The framework offers a tiny version that focuses on basic functionality such as layout and routing, which simplifies the initial setup process.
- Latest Technology Stack: With upgrades to Vite 7.x, React 19.1.1, and various other tools, the project ensures optimal performance and cutting-edge capabilities.
- Comprehensive State Management: Built with MobX for lightweight state management, making it easier to control and track state changes throughout the application.
- Internationalization (i18n): Incorporates react-intl-hooks for effective internationalization, allowing easy adaptation for global users.
- Robust UI Components: Utilizes Ant Design for a stable and feature-rich UI, ensuring a polished experience across the dashboard.
- Detailed User Management Features: Includes functionalities like strong validation, role management, and file uploads, perfect for comprehensive user control.
- Advanced Monitoring Capabilities: Offers front-end metrics collection and displays via ECharts, allowing for data visualization directly within the dashboard.
- Configurable and Maintainable: The project’s configuration and code structure allow for straightforward maintenance and adaptation, making it suitable for ongoing improvements.